GOAT is a high-risk speculative bet, suitable only for money you can afford to lose entirely. As a pure attention asset with no revenue or utility, Goatseus Maximus (GOAT) can deliver outsized gains during an AI-narrative revival and can bleed toward zero during the quiet stretches that claim most meme coins. Whether it belongs in a portfolio depends less on the token and more on the investor's risk tolerance and time horizon.
The Case For GOAT
The bull argument rests on provenance. GOAT is the token that proved an autonomous AI could mint a billion-dollar meme, and that "first" is a scarce distinction. Historical firsts in crypto have shown staying power as collector assets even through long droughts, and GOAT owns its place in that story outright.
The supply structure helps too. As covered in our GOAT tokenomics breakdown, the token is fair-launched with almost its entire supply already circulating, so holders face no vesting cliffs or team dumps. If the AI-agent category catches another cycle, the progenitor is a natural candidate to lead it, and the near-total float means demand translates cleanly into price.
The Case Against GOAT
The bear argument is simpler and, for meme coins, usually correct: attention fades. GOAT has already dropped more than 99% from its November 2024 high near $1.35, and its demand hinges on a single AI account, Truth Terminal, staying relevant. Our explainer on the AI bot that created GOAT makes the dependency clear, and a token tied to one persona's cultural pull is fragile by construction.
Liquidity compounds the risk. GOAT trades in a thin market where large early holders can exit into shallow depth, and a low-cap meme coin offers no fundamentals to cushion a sell-off. There is no revenue, no roadmap, and no floor.

Who GOAT Actually Suits
GOAT fits a specific type of participant. It works for traders who understand meme-coin momentum, size positions small, and treat the token as a sentiment vehicle rather than a long-term store of value. The scenario ranges in our GOAT price prediction show why: the realistic outcomes span from a slow fade to a sharp narrative-driven rally, with little in between.
It does not fit anyone seeking steady appreciation, yield, or exposure to a working product. As Decrypt has documented, AI-agent tokens as a group swing violently on sentiment, and GOAT is among the most sentiment-driven of them. The right position size is one that survives a total loss without damage.

The Honest Verdict on GOAT
GOAT is a wager on culture and attention, packaged as a token with a real place in crypto history. That makes it interesting and dangerous in equal measure. The bull case needs a fresh AI-agent cycle. The bear case is the gravity that pulls most meme coins down over time.
